Where: Phoenix Rod and Gun Club
What: DMR/SPR rifle match(rifle only; scope required, 4x magnifier minimum)
Why: I make rifles and we all have one, so come and shoot it
When: Aug. 25th, 6:45 range brief, start shooting at 7am. Range brief is required, so don't be late!
How: Any DMR/SPR rifle with no steel core ammo, if you ruin my steel you will buy it.

Specifics:
Cost $15 for members; $20 for non-members,
There will be at least 8 stages of fire, distance will range from cqb to 500+ yards, targets will be generous(in my mind)
Round count will be around 80 rounds if you don't miss.
We will squad up in the morning and stay with designated squads, pertinent info will be given during range/safety brief.
223 up to 308 caliber will be allowed as long as you have ammo that will not damage our steel.
this will be a mixture of shooting, some run and gun, some prone, some obstacles(Im fat and i can do it) and other props will be used. we will probably use the mover as well!
We will be shooting all steel targets and have spotters within the squad.

If you don't know what a SPR rifle or a DMR rifle is, google it. You will not be allowed to switch rifles/optics once the match starts. flip down magnifiers can be used.

If you want a hint of what we'll be doing, this saturday is our precision rifle match down at PRGC@7am, it will be similiar but with semi-auto rifles.
